Question:

Seventy percent of the employees in a multinational corporation have VCD players, 75% have microwave ovens, 80% have ACS and 85% have washing machines. At least what percentage of employees has all four gadgets?

Solution and Explanation

We are given the following information: - 70% of employees have VCD players. - 75% of employees have microwave ovens. - 80% of employees have ACS. - 85% of employees have washing machines. The minimum percentage of employees having all four gadgets can be found using the principle of inclusion and exclusion. The sum of all the individual percentages is: \[ 70 + 75 + 80 + 85 = 310 \] Since the total percentage of employees cannot exceed 100%, the sum of overlaps (i.e., employees with at least one of these gadgets) is \( 310 - 100 = 210 \). The minimum overlap (employees having all four gadgets) must be at least: \[ 310 - 3 \times 100 = 10 \] Thus, at least 10% of employees must have all four gadgets. Therefore, the Correct Answer is 10%. \[ \boxed{10} \]
